Recommendation for readers who have an interest in checking out the topic further

For readers captivated by the mysteries of the afterlife, "Is Death The Final Destination?: A Glimpse of The Afterlife" by John White is a captivating read that explores extensive concerns. To further explore this thought-provoking topic, consider diving into works like "Life After Life" by Raymond Moody and "The Tibetan Book of Living and Dying" by Sogyal Rinpoche.

These books provide varied viewpoints on what lies beyond our earthly presence, enhancing your understanding of the afterlife. In addition, checking out Near-Death Experience (NDE) accounts shared in books such as "Proof of Heaven" by Eben Alexander can supply remarkable insights into the possible extension of awareness post-death.
